ECSE 6200 - Semiconductor Device Characterization


This graduate-level course is designed to give students a hands-on experience in the characterization of basic semiconductor devices (diffused resistors, pn junction diodes, Schottky diodes, MOS capacitors, bipolar junction transistors, MOSFETs) in wafer and/or packaged forms. The final project involves the students in a detailed characterization of devices in a specific application (e.g. high-voltage power electronics, submicron ULSI, microwave and wireless).

Prerequisites/Corequisites: Prerequisite: ECSE 6230.

When Offered: Spring term even-numbered years.



Credit Hours: 3

Contact, Lecture or Lab Hours: 3
